Output 39aec4d859af05f070b64d4584c82da76c2f783f99175a8cf4e7aef295ec5a32:1

value
62141348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f009406c97e733827a21ccfd0ec83b14c60921a3 OP_EQUAL
address
3PaDBQ81d51gzeDKphgDk3V7ukPTsw8cxg
transaction
39aec4d859af05f070b64d4584c82da76c2f783f99175a8cf4e7aef295ec5a32
spent
true